viking60 wrote:"Someone" will be able to pin point your exact location though. And if you surf with a smartphone they will be able to do so 24/7 Like with German Green party politician Malte Spitz:
He went to court and forced the German Telecom to give him his own data and put it on the Internet to make his point. Here you can see his movements for 6 months - in detail - every minute of the day.

On ANY cell phone, if you don't keep your GPS turned off, then you are liable for this yes. The problem is, most think it's the greatest thing on this earth, and it can be - if used correctly. Mine stays turned off until/if I have an emergency (and I'm talking the "dial 911 because" type, and that is only so emergency people can find me). Meh. People are stupid.
